Understanding Dental Clips and Their Functions

Dental clips function as mechanical retention devices designed to hold materials, wires, or appliances in precise positions during dental procedures. Their primary purpose involves maintaining stability and proper alignment throughout treatment processes. These devices work by creating controlled pressure points that secure components without causing damage to surrounding tissues or structures.

The functionality of dental clips extends beyond simple retention. They facilitate better access for dental professionals during procedures, reduce treatment time, and often improve patient comfort by eliminating the need for prolonged manual holding of materials. Modern dental clips incorporate ergonomic designs that minimize tissue irritation while maximizing holding power.

Common Types of Dental Clips Used in the US

Several distinct categories of dental clips are widely utilized in American dental practices. Orthodontic clips represent the most recognizable type, designed specifically for securing archwires to brackets during orthodontic treatment. These clips typically feature spring-loaded mechanisms that allow for easy engagement and disengagement.

Restorative dental clips serve different purposes, primarily focusing on temporary crown retention, matrix band stabilization, and composite material positioning. Surgical clips find application in oral surgery procedures, helping to control bleeding and secure tissue positioning during healing processes.

Endodontic clips assist in root canal procedures by maintaining rubber dam isolation and securing access points. Periodontal clips support gum treatment procedures by holding tissue in optimal positions for cleaning and surgical interventions.

Dental Clip Safety and Maintenance Tips

Proper sterilization protocols remain critical for dental clip safety and longevity. Autoclave sterilization represents the gold standard, requiring specific temperature and pressure parameters to ensure complete pathogen elimination. Ultrasonic cleaning prior to sterilization helps remove debris from intricate clip mechanisms.

Regular inspection of dental clips helps identify wear patterns, stress fractures, or corrosion that could compromise performance. Damaged clips should be immediately removed from service to prevent potential complications during procedures.

Storage considerations include maintaining clips in organized, sterile environments with appropriate humidity control. Proper handling techniques minimize mechanical stress and extend operational lifespan.

Choosing the Right Dental Clip for Your Needs

Selecting appropriate dental clips requires consideration of multiple factors including procedure type, patient anatomy, and expected treatment duration. Material compatibility with existing dental work and potential allergic reactions must be evaluated before clip selection.

Size and force specifications should align with specific procedural requirements. Clips that are too small may not provide adequate retention, while oversized options could cause unnecessary tissue trauma or patient discomfort.

Cost-effectiveness analysis should balance initial clip expense against expected lifespan and reusability factors. Single-use clips may be appropriate for certain procedures, while multi-use options provide better long-term value for routine applications.
